What are the important warnings I should know before using the FENIX TK20R UE flashlight?

Please adhere to the following warnings when using your FENIX TK20R UE flashlight:

• The flashlight is a high-intensity lighting device capable of causing eye damage to the user or others. Avoid shining the flashlight directly into anyone’s eyes.

• This flashlight will accumulate a great deal of heat when used for extended periods, resulting in a high temperature of the flashlight shell. Pay attention to safe use to avoid scalding.

• Do not shine an object at close range, to avoid burning the object or causing danger due to high temperature.

• The LED of this flashlight is not replaceable; so the entire light should be replaced when the LED reaches the end of its life.

How do I operate the switches on the FENIX TK20R UE?

The FENIX TK20R UE has two switches for operation:

Tactical Tail Switch: This is the main switch for momentary-on and constant-on activation.

FlexiSensa Control Rotary Switch: This switch is for mode switching and output selection.


How do I turn the FENIX TK20R UE on and off?

Tap and hold the Tactical Tail Switch to momentarily turn on the light; it will go out once you release it.

Fully press the Tactical Tail Switch to constantly turn on the light (with a click sound), and press it again to turn off the light.


How do I switch between modes on the FENIX TK20R UE?

To switch between the different modes on your FENIX TK20R UE, use the FlexiSensa Control rotary switch:

• Rotate the FlexiSensa Control to the left to enter Tactical mode.

• Rotate the FlexiSensa Control to the middle to enter Duty mode.

• Rotate the FlexiSensa Control to the right to enter Lockout mode.


How do I select different brightness levels on the FENIX TK20R UE?

In Duty Mode: With the light switched on, rotate the FlexiSensa Control to cycle through Low -> Med -> High -> Turbo.

In Tactical Mode: With the light switched on, the FENIX TK20R UE will activate Turbo mode. Half-press the Tactical Tail Switch to activate Strobe.


How do I activate the Strobe function on the FENIX TK20R UE?

With the light switched on and in Tactical mode, half-press the Tactical Tail Switch to enter Strobe. To exit Strobe, fully press the Tactical Tail Switch to turn off the light.


What are the technical parameters of the FENIX TK20R UE?

TURBO HIGH MED LOW STROBE
OUTPUT 2800 lumens 1000 lumens 350 lumens 30 lumens 2800 lumens
RUNTIME 3 hours* 3 hours 40 mins 9 hours 40 hours /
DISTANCE 465 meters 265 meters 150 meters 50 meters /
INTENSITY 53,320 candela 17,580 candela 5,820 candela 660 candela /
IMPACT RESISTANCE 1 meter
SUBMERSIBLE IP68, 2 meters underwater

Note: The above specifications are from the results produced by Fenix through its laboratory testing using the Fenix ARB-L21-5000 V2.0 battery under the temperature of 21±3°C and humidity of 50% – 80%. The true performance of this product may vary according to different working environments and the actual battery used.

*The Turbo output is measured in a total of runtime including output at reduced levels due to temperature or protection mechanism in the design.


What are the recommended battery specifications for the FENIX TK20R UE?

Type Dimensions Nominal Voltage Usability
Fenix ARB-L21 series rechargeable Li-ion battery 21700 3.6 V Recommended

Warning: Do not mix batteries of different brands, sizes, capacities or types. Doing so may cause damage to the flashlight or the batteries being used.

*21700 Li-ion batteries are powerful cells designed for commercial applications and must be treated with caution and handled with care. Only using quality batteries with circuit protection will reduce the potential for combustion or explosion; but cell damage or short circuiting are potential risks the user assumes.


How does the intelligent memory circuit work on the FENIX TK20R UE?

The FENIX TK20R UE memorizes the last selected output in Duty mode. When turned on again, the previously used output in Duty mode will be recalled.


How does the intelligent overheat protection feature work on the FENIX TK20R UE?

The flashlight will accumulate a lot of heat when used in Turbo mode for extended periods. When the light reaches a temperature of 60°C or above, the light will automatically step down a few lumens to reduce the temperature. When the temperature drops below 60°C, it will then allow the user to reselect Turbo mode.


How does the low-voltage warning function on the FENIX TK20R UE?

When the voltage level drops below the preset level, the FENIX TK20R UE is programmed to downshift to a lower brightness level until Low output is reached. When this happens in Low output, the battery level indicator blinks red to remind you to recharge or replace the battery.


How can I check the battery level of my FENIX TK20R UE?

With the light switched off, rotate the FlexiSensa Control from the Lockout mode to Duty mode. The battery level indicator will be displayed for 3 seconds.

• Green light on: saturated, 100% – 85%

• Green light flashes: sufficient, 85% – 50%

• Red light on: poor, 50% – 25%

• Red light flashes: critical, 25% – 1%

Note: This only works with the Fenix ARB-L21 series battery.


How do I replace the battery in the FENIX TK20R UE?

To replace the battery in your FENIX TK20R UE, follow these steps:

1. Unscrew the light tail from the light body.

2. Insert the battery with the anode side (+) towards the light head.

3. Screw the light tail back on.


How do I charge the FENIX TK20R UE flashlight?

Follow these steps to charge your FENIX TK20R UE:

1. First, switch off the light and reveal the USB Type-C charging port by twisting the light head counterclockwise.

2. Plug the USB-A end of the charging cable into an electrical outlet, then connect the USB Type-C end of the charging cable to the light.

3. During charging, the charging indicator will display red. It will turn green when fully charged.

4. Once charging is complete, be sure to tighten the light head to maintain the waterproof and dustproof ability.

Note:

1. The normal charging time is approximately 3.5 hours from depletion to fully charged.

2. Recharge a stored light every four months to maintain the optimum performance of the battery.

3. The Low output is available while charging.


What are the usage and maintenance recommendations for the FENIX TK20R UE?

To ensure optimal performance of your FENIX TK20R UE, please follow these maintenance tips:

• Disassembling the sealed head can cause damage to the light and will void the warranty.

• Fenix recommends using only a high-quality protected battery.

• If the light will not be used for an extended period, remove the battery for storage. Otherwise the light could be damaged by electrolyte leakage or battery explosion.

• Lock out the light or remove the battery to prevent accidental activation during storage or transport.

• Long-term use can result in O-ring wear. To maintain a proper water seal, replace the ring with an approved spare.

• Periodic cleaning of the battery contacts improves the light’s performance as dirty contacts may cause the light to flicker, shine intermittently or even fail to illuminate for the following reasons:

A: Poor battery level. Solution: Recharge the battery.

B: The contact or contact point of the battery or flashlight is dirty. Solution: Clean the contact points with a cotton swab soaked in rubbing alcohol.
